About the role

  • Support the planning and execution of marketing initiatives for Hot Topic’s Music business, ensuring alignment with established brand vision, customer experience, and growth priorities.
  • Develop and execute integrated marketing plans for artists and music-related product launches, including albums, merchandise, content drops, and live or experiential activations.
  • Contribute creative ideas and campaign concepts, applying powerful storytelling, strong positioning, and culturally relevant creative direction.
  • Responsible for campaign measurement and collaboration with the brand team.
  • Lead campaign execution, including kick-offs, timelines, and cross-functional workflows to ensure marketing deliverables are completed on time and at scale.
  • Partner cross-functionally with Promotions, Social Media, Influencer Marketing, CRM, Digital Advertising, Creative, Merchandising, Ecommerce, Store Ops, and Licensing to execute integrated and compliant campaigns. Coordinate brand marketing integrations across consumer-facing digital platforms, social channels, and in-store experiences.
  • Collaborate with external partners across labels, management teams, distributors, licensors, and talent agencies to support campaign execution and activations.
  • Identify marketing opportunities and white space, and provide recommendations for external activations such as tour sponsorships, festival booths, and in-store events.
  • Track and report on campaign performance, leveraging metrics and insights to provide optimization opportunities and inform ROI-focused decision-making.
  • Share campaign, progress, results, and learnings with stakeholders and leadership to support continuous improvement.
  • Regularly interface with artists, management, and music stakeholders to support alignment on commercial release plans, branding, and campaign execution.
  • Collaborate with content and copy teams to ensure brand voice and messaging consistency across channels.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of marketing experience, preferably within music, retail, brand, entertainment, or franchise marketing
  • Experience working with record companies, artist management teams, talent agencies, or entertainment partners
  • Strong understanding of artist development, streaming/digital business models, touring, festivals, and pop culture trends
  • Proven ability to define and drive project management, execution, and cross-functional collaboration
  • Creative thinker with a passion for innovative marketing ideas and cultural storytelling
  • Excellent communication, writing, presentation, and stakeholder management skills
  • Strong communication skills including ability to work in a team environment, give honest, direct feedback and is a solid verbal and written communicator
  • Meets deadlines, prioritizes appropriately, copes well with change, and maintains composure under pressure
  • Accountable for results, approaches obstacles proactively and looks for ways to resolve problems and issues
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int), project management tools, and budget tracking/reconciliation
  • Bachelor’s Degree required, preferably in Marketing or related field
